Science has had a tremendous impact on the modern world, shaping the way we live, work, and think. From the development of the printing press and the steam engine to the creation of the internet and the development of vaccines, scientific advances have transformed the way we interact with the world and with each other.

One of the most significant impacts of science on the modern world is the way it has changed the way we communicate. The development of the printing press in the 15th century revolutionized the way information was disseminated, making it possible for ideas to be shared widely and quickly. Today, the internet has taken this even further, allowing people from all corners of the globe to connect and share information in real time.

Science has also had a major impact on the way we work. The industrial revolution, which was driven by advances in science and technology, brought about significant changes in the way we produce and consume goods. Today, automation and artificial intelligence are transforming the way we do business, making many tasks faster and more efficient.

In addition to changing the way we work and communicate, science has also had a significant impact on the way we think. The scientific method, which involves making observations, forming hypotheses, testing those hypotheses through experimentation, and drawing conclusions based on the results, has become the dominant way of understanding the world. This approach has led to many of the discoveries that have shaped our modern world, including the discovery of DNA, the theory of evolution, and the laws of thermodynamics.

One of the most important ways in which science has impacted the modern world is through the development of medicine. From the discovery of penicillin and the development of vaccines to the creation of new drugs and treatments for diseases, science has played a crucial role in improving public health and increasing life expectancy.

Overall, it is clear that science has had a profound impact on the modern world. From the way we communicate and work to the way we think and the way we care for our health, science has shaped the world we live in and will continue to do so in the future.
